The government will spend about PLN 3 billion (EUR 0.62 billion) from the state budget on coal subsidies for local governments, Mateusz Morawiecki, the prime minister, has said.
The government has prepared a bill that will offer refunds for local governments if the price of coal they have to purchase exceeds PLN 2,000 (EUR 413) per tonne, Mateusz Morawiecki, the prime minister, has said.
